Whitecroft, Oxhill, Warwick, CV35 0RH is a freehold det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 872 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.
The estimated current market value of the property is £469,734 , which equates to approximately £539 per square foot. It was last sold on 6 Sep 2016 for £355,000. Since then, the value has increased by £114,734, representing a 32.3% increase, or approximately 3.5% per year.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 31 October 2014,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.
Whitecroft, Oxhill, Warwick, Stratford-On-Avon, Warwickshire, CV35 0RH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 31 Oct 2014.
This property uses an oil-fired boiler with radiators as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.
